I started adding fitness pal to track my eating and get on track to lose weight. To achieve my weight goal, it recommends 1500 daily calories. I am 59 years old and since tracking my calories my weight has increased. Very frustrating, I do walk at least 10000 steps a day and if working up to 27000 steps a day. I do work 3rd shift so my sleep alternates, I try to exercise with either line dancing or strength training. I do notice my calorie allowance goes up w exercise- so do you have to increase calories? Sometimes I do, but doesn’t seem to help no matter what I try
